Many LA homes still have older, basic rectangular pools. They work, but they often do not match how people like to relax and entertain today. Spring is a great time to rethink the shape and layout so the pool fits your yard, not the other way around.
You might choose a more organic shape with soft curves to echo surrounding planting or a clean, modern geometric design with straight lines that match your home’s style. Resizing the pool or adjusting the footprint can also open up more deck space for loungers, a fire feature, or an outdoor dining area.
Shallow lounging areas, often called Baja shelves, are a favorite update. These wide, shallow sections let you set a chair in the water, sit with kids, or just cool your feet on a warm spring day. They make the pool feel more welcoming for all ages, not just strong swimmers.
Built-in features inside the pool add comfort without clutter. Integrated seating and benches along one side allow you to sit and chat without floating away. Wide, gently graded steps are easier to use and feel less crowded than skinny ladders. Tanning ledges and spots for in-pool umbrellas can create shaded hangout zones right in the water.
Outside the pool, think about the flow from the water to the patio. A good layout connects the pool, lounge, and outdoor kitchen so people can move easily from swimming to snacking to relaxing. Clear paths, smart transitions between different materials, and planned sightlines help the space feel larger and more open. When the pool, patio, and social areas work together, hosting spring get-togethers feels simple instead of stressful.
If the pool finish is rough, faded, or stained, spring is an ideal time to resurface. Many homeowners now choose pebble, quartz, or other aggregate finishes instead of plain plaster. These options can give the water a richer color and more interesting texture while standing up to LA’s bright sun.
Refreshing the finish before peak swimming season means you are not stuck closing the pool when everyone wants to use it. It also gives you a chance to address any small cracks or wear before they become larger problems.
Around the pool, pavers and quality hardscape materials can completely change the look and feel of your patio. Pavers are popular for a backyard pool & patio remodel in Los Angeles because they allow better drainage and are easier to repair. If a section is damaged, it is usually possible to replace individual pieces instead of redoing the entire area.
Choosing lighter-colored pavers or concrete can help keep surfaces more comfortable under bare feet as the sun gets stronger. Texture also matters. Non-slip finishes and thoughtful grading help reduce puddles and tripping hazards. Rounded coping and smooth edges around the pool blend safety with a polished, high-end appearance.
With the right combination of finishes and hardscape, the whole space feels refreshed, not just the pool itself.
Once the pool and patio layout are set, it is time to think about comfort. In LA, shade is gold. Pergolas, shade sails, and covered patios give you places to relax without feeling baked by the sun. These structures can be simple or very custom, but they all add usable space.
To stretch your outdoor season, consider adding ceiling fans under covered areas, heaters, or a fire pit feature. That way, your backyard stays inviting from cooler spring evenings through the rest of the year.
Outdoor kitchens turn the patio into the main event. Built-in BBQs, side burners, bars, and prep counters let you cook and serve without running in and out of the house. With good planning, everything you need for a weekend hangout can live outside.

A great pool area always balances hard surfaces with soft greenery. In Los Angeles, low-water plants make sense. Drought-tolerant and native species can still feel full and lush when placed well.
Layered planting around the edges of the pool and fence line can add privacy, soften the lines of the hardscape, and create a calm, resort-like mood. Raised planters or neatly framed beds keep roots and soil contained. Choosing plants that do not drop heavy leaves right into the pool helps cut back on cleaning.
Artificial turf is another smart add-on for many backyards. It stays green, needs very little upkeep, and pairs nicely with pavers and patios. You can use it between stepping stones, around lounging zones, or in play areas for kids or pets. It gives you that soft, grassy look without worrying about bare patches or muddy spots.
Eco-friendly pool systems round out the picture. Variable-speed pumps, efficient heaters, and LED pool lights help lower energy use and long-term wear. Smart controllers and automation make it easy to run your pool and outdoor lighting from your phone. For busy LA homeowners, this kind of control can make everyday upkeep feel less like a chore.
All these choices work together to create a space that is beautiful, practical, and more mindful of water and energy use.
